Cause IQ has information on 6,815 community food services nonprofits. These organizations typically have revenues from $105,463 to $2.3 million, between 0 and 23 employees, and are 501(c)(3)s. Community food services nonprofits in Cause IQ can also be emergency and relief services, civic and social organizations, and individual and family services.
